    Subject[PATCH 4.19 188/287] ext4: make sure ext4_append() always allocates new block
    Date
    From: Lukas Czerner <lczerner@redhat.com>

    commit b8a04fe77ef1360fbf73c80fddbdfeaa9407ed1b upstream.

    ext4_append() must always allocate a new block, otherwise we run the
    risk of overwriting existing directory block corrupting the directory
    tree in the process resulting in all manner of problems later on.

    Add a sanity check to see if the logical block is already allocated and
    error out if it is.

    fs/ext4/namei.c | 16 ++++++++++++++++
    1 file changed, 16 insertions(+)

    --- a/fs/ext4/namei.c
    +++ b/fs/ext4/namei.c
    @@ -53,6 +53,7 @@ static struct buffer_head *ext4_append(h
    struct inode *inode,
    ext4_lblk_t *block)
    {
    + struct ext4_map_blocks map;
    struct buffer_head *bh;
    int err;

    @@ -62,6 +63,21 @@ static struct buffer_head *ext4_append(h
    return ERR_PTR(-ENOSPC);

    *block = inode->i_size >> inode->i_sb->s_blocksize_bits;
    + map.m_lblk = *block;
    + map.m_len = 1;
    +
    + /*
    + * We're appending new directory block. Make sure the block is not
    + * allocated yet, otherwise we will end up corrupting the
    + * directory.
    + */
    + err = ext4_map_blocks(NULL, inode, &map, 0);
    + if (err < 0)
    + return ERR_PTR(err);
    + if (err) {
    + EXT4_ERROR_INODE(inode, "Logical block already allocated");
    + return ERR_PTR(-EFSCORRUPTED);
    + }

    bh = ext4_bread(handle, inode, *block, EXT4_GET_BLOCKS_CREATE);
    if (IS_ERR(bh))
